Title: The Afrobeat Revolution: Fela Kuti's Hysterical High Jinks In the pulsating heart of Lagos, Nigeria, a musical maverick by the name of Fela Kuti set the stage ablaze with his uproarious Afrobeat sound. With an infectious blend of jazz, funk, and traditional African rhythms, Kuti's music became the soundtrack of a revolution, punctuating the volatile political climate of the 1970s. But it wasn't just his music that stirred the masses; it was Kuti's audacious personality and penchant for mischief that truly set him apart. From his wild stage antics to his unabashed criticism of corruption, Fela Kuti fearlessly used his music as a weapon against oppression, ruffling feathers and making headlines all over the world. His concerts were a sight to behold, as Fela, draped in a vibrant dashiki, danced with an untamed energy that sent audiences into a frenzy. The crowd, hypnotized by his unmistakable saxophone solos and infectious rhythms, would join in, their bodies moving like marionettes in his powerful musical symphony.
